DIGEST 

Currently, Texas law does not provide an institution or facility that
transports people with disabilities a special license plate or parking
placard. This bill would allow certain institutions or facilities that
transport people with disabilities to apply for a specialty license plate
or disabled parking placard. 

PURPOSE

As proposed, S.B. 21 issues specialty license plates or disabled parking
placards to certain institutions and facilities that transport persons with
disabilities.

SECTION BY SECTION ANALYSIS

SECTION 1. Amends Chapter 502F, Transportation Code, by adding Section
502.2531, as follows:  

Sec. 502.2531. ISSUANCE OF DISABLED PLATES TO CERTAIN INSTITUTIONS. (a)
Requires the Texas Department of Transportation (TxDOT) to provide for the
issuance of specially designed license plates under Section 502.253 for a
van or bus operated by an institution in which a person described by
Section 502.253(b) resides. 

(b) Requires the application for registration to be made in the manner
provided by Section 502.253(d) and be accompanied by a written statement
signed by the administrator of the institution certifying that the
institution transports persons described  by Section 502.253(b).   

SECTION 2. Amends Chapter 681, Transportation Code, by adding Section
681.0032, as follows:  

Sec. 681.0032. ISSUANCE OF DISABLED PARKING PLACARDS TO CERTAIN
INSTITUTIONS. (a) Requires TxDOT to provide for the issuance of disabled
parking placards described by Section 681.002 for a van or bus operated by
an institution in which a person described by Section 502.253(b) resides. 

(b) Requires the application for a disabled parking placard to be made in
the manner provided by Section 681.003(b) and be accompanied by a written
statement signed by the administrator of the institution to certify to
TxDOT that the institution transports persons described by Section
502.253(b).
